PpspA-CoaBC
Description
This composite part is a component of the IFN-γ sensing system and was used to express the taurine production enzyme, CoaBC.
Biology
Binding of IFN-γ to the OmpA/OprF chimeric protein induces the response of the phage shock protein (Psp) system, a highly conserved stress response system in enterobacteria. [1] Signal transduction from the outer membrane to the inner membrane activates the pspA promoter, initiating expression of CoaBC. CoaBC converts L-cystate into taurine in the taurine synthesis L-cystate pathway.

Usage
We ligased the coaBC fragment and pspA promoter on the pSU expression vector and transformed it into DH5α to complete construction of the plasmid.
